For instance, we read in Leviticus 4:20 that upon the sacrifice of a young bull, the priest was to make atonement for the unintentional sin of the congregation, and it shall be forgiven them. Also, verse 26 says that upon the sacrifice of a young male goat, the rulers unintentional sin shall be forgiven him. Also, in regard to an unintentional sin of a common person, we read that upon the sacrifice of a female kid of the goats, the priest shall make atonement for him, and it shall be forgiven him (verses 31, 35). The Jamieson, Fausset and Brown Commentary concurs, saying this about Leviticus 4:35: None of these sacrifices possessed any intrinsic value sufficient to free the conscience of the sinner from the pollution of guilt, or to obtain his pardon from God; but they gave a formal deliverance from a secular penalty (Heb 9:13, 14); and they were figurative representations of the full and perfect sin offering which was to be made by Christ., The (above-mentioned) passage in Hebrews 9:13-14 shows indeed what kind of forgiveness could be obtained through animal sacrifices.
